Emerging Technologies and Best Practices in Responsible Gaming

Technology is revolutionizing how operators implement regulatory compliance and prioritize player protection. Artificial intelligence (AI), machine learning, and data analytics enable real-time monitoring of gambling behavior, allowing for early intervention if risky patterns emerge. Such tools are vital in adhering to strict anti-money laundering (AML) regulations and ensuring fair play.

Technology Application Industry Impact
AI & Machine Learning Detecting problem gambling patterns Enhanced player safety; reduces regulatory penalties
Blockchain Ensuring transparency & fair gaming Increased trust; facilitates compliance with audit standards
Biometric Verification Preventing underage gambling & identity fraud Strengthening legal compliance & customer confidence

The Role of Licensing and Certification in Building Industry Credibility

Beyond technology, robust licensing frameworks and certifications serve as independent attestations of a platform’s legitimacy. Many jurisdictions mandate licensing from reputable bodies like the Malta Gaming Authority, UK Gambling Commission, or provincial regulators in Canada. Such certifications demonstrate a platform’s commitment to fair play, data security, and responsible gambling.

Industry Challenges and Future Outlook

While technological solutions and stringent regulations have improved industry standards, challenges persist. The proliferation of unlicensed operators, the constant evolution of online platforms, and emerging markets require ongoing regulatory adaptation. Moreover, increasing scrutiny around data privacy and addiction prevention emphasizes the need for holistic approaches to regulation and responsible gaming.
